How do they approach remodeling, additions, and finishing details that stand up in Northeast Ohio?
RILEY CONTRACTING LLC. plans remodels and additions around structural integrity, orderly sequencing, and clean finishes that elevate daily living. Kitchens and baths benefit from tight carpentry and moisture-aware detailing; living areas gain definition through custom casing, built-ins, and stair work; and new rooms are framed to match existing loads and layout. In older homes, their team modernizes systems while preserving character through precise trim profiles and matched materials, then ties everything together with durable finishes. Basements, attics, and garages are frequently turned into conditioned living zones through insulation upgrades, egress solutions, and smart storage built-ins that make the new space practical and code-compliant. Roof, siding, and flashing inspections and Custom millwork and carpentry detailing are integrated early so problems are solved before drywall and paint. Weatherproofing is not an afterthought: proper flashing, air sealing, and window/door integration help finishes perform and look better for years, supporting both comfort and value.
Need help with exterior improvements, from roofs to driveways and decks?
For exteriors, the company’s process begins with a thorough condition check of the envelope—roof planes, siding transitions, and all penetrations—so repairs and upgrades address causes, not symptoms. Roofing work includes installation and repairs, shingle-to-flashing transitions, and chimney tie-ins; siding services cover vinyl and aluminum installations and repairs, along with window and door replacement that improves weather shedding and curb appeal. Masonry capabilities extend to tuck pointing, cut-and-plug brick repair, chimney builds and rebuilds, and foundation remediation that protects the structure long term. Outdoor additions are designed to live well and last—decks, porches, and entries are framed and finished with the same care as interior carpentry. Driveways and walkways are handled in-house with asphalt and concrete placement, followed by sealcoating and HCF (hot/cold crack filler) to maximize service life. The result is a single-source team that can rebuild the envelope, refresh the façade, and renew hard surfaces, aligning exterior_improvement and weatherproofing strategies with the home’s architecture.
